The Showstopper: Sheikh Zayed Grand Mosque
No visit to Abu Dhabi is complete without seeing the Sheikh Zayed Grand Mosque. This architectural jewel combines Moorish, Mughal, and Ottoman influences, creating a majestic and harmonious structure. The white marble, gold accents, and intricate carvings are breathtaking, especially when sunlight hits the surfaces. The mosque can hold over 40,000 worshippers, making it the largest in the UAE.
The world’s largest hand-knotted carpet, imported from Iran, adds to the grandeur, and the reflection of the mosque in the water pools makes for stunning photos. Visitors often comment on its peaceful atmosphere and the beauty of its floral and geometric motifs.
Tip: Modest dress is required, and women are provided with abayas, making it easy to visit comfortably.

Modern Icons and Artistic Delights
The next highlight is the Louvre Abu Dhabi, a masterpiece of architecture and a hub of diverse art collections. You’ll find artifacts from ancient Egypt, Greek sculptures, Islamic textiles, and European paintings by masters like Monet and Van Gogh. The galleries are thoughtfully curated, making it a highlight for culture enthusiasts and art lovers.
